#1764c5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1764c5 is composed of 9% red, 39.2%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.3% cyan, 49.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 213.4 degrees, a saturation of 79.1% and a lightness of 43.1%. #1764c5 color hex could be obtained by blending #2ec8ff with #00008b.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

#1764c5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1764c5 has RGB values of R:23, G:100, B:197 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0.49,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 1533125.
